  • Mybatis Generator自定义扩展

    最近在使用Mybatis Generator生成代码的时候,发现只能生成部分增删改查的方法。

    研究了一下自定义扩展的方法。

    本次扩展中使用的包:mysql-connector-java-5.1.30.jar,mybatis-generator-core-1.3.5.jar

    项目已经添加到码云上

    码云地址 :https://gitee.com/xxxcxy/support-generator

    生成之后的Mapper文件

    其中:find,list,pageList是自定义生成的。

    这个是自定义的插件

    <plugin type="org.mybatis.generator.plugins.CustomPlugin">

     继承MyBatisGenerator 的 PluginAdapter

    /**
     * 自定义插件
     * 增加
     * 1. find
     * 2. list
     * 3. pageList
     * 
     * 参考
     * @see org.mybatis.generator.plugins.ToStringPlugin
     * @author My
     */
    public class CustomPlugin extends PluginAdapter {
    
        @Override
        public boolean validate(List<String> warnings) {
            return true;
        }
        
        @Override
        public boolean sqlMapDocumentGenerated(Document document, IntrospectedTable introspectedTable) {
            AbstractXmlElementGenerator elementGenerator = new CustomAbstractXmlElementGenerator();
            elementGenerator.setContext(context);
            elementGenerator.setIntrospectedTable(introspectedTable);
            elementGenerator.addElements(document.getRootElement());
            return super.sqlMapDocumentGenerated(document, introspectedTable);
        }
    
        @Override
        public boolean clientGenerated(Interface interfaze, TopLevelClass topLevelClass, IntrospectedTable introspectedTable) {
            AbstractJavaMapperMethodGenerator methodGenerator = new CustomJavaMapperMethodGenerator();
            methodGenerator.setContext(context);
            methodGenerator.setIntrospectedTable(introspectedTable);
            methodGenerator.addInterfaceElements(interfaze);
            return super.clientGenerated(interfaze, topLevelClass, introspectedTable);
        }
    }

     CustomAbstractXmlElementGenerator 代码

    public class CustomAbstractXmlElementGenerator extends AbstractXmlElementGenerator {
    
        @Override
        public void addElements(XmlElement parentElement) {
            // 增加base_query
            XmlElement sql = new XmlElement("sql");
            sql.addAttribute(new Attribute("id", "base_query"));
            //在这里添加where条件
            XmlElement selectTrimElement = new XmlElement("trim"); //设置trim标签
            selectTrimElement.addAttribute(new Attribute("prefix", "WHERE"));  
            selectTrimElement.addAttribute(new Attribute("prefixOverrides", "AND | OR")); //添加where和and
            StringBuilder sb = new StringBuilder();
            for(IntrospectedColumn introspectedColumn : introspectedTable.getAllColumns()) {
                XmlElement selectNotNullElement = new XmlElement("if"); //$NON-NLS-1$
                sb.setLength(0);
                sb.append("null != ");
                sb.append(introspectedColumn.getJavaProperty());
                selectNotNullElement.addAttribute(new Attribute("test", sb.toString()));
                sb.setLength(0);
                // 添加and
                sb.append(" and ");
                // 添加别名t
                sb.append("t.");
                sb.append(MyBatis3FormattingUtilities.getEscapedColumnName(introspectedColumn));
                // 添加等号
                sb.append(" = ");
                sb.append(MyBatis3FormattingUtilities.getParameterClause(introspectedColumn));
                selectNotNullElement.addElement(new TextElement(sb.toString()));
                selectTrimElement.addElement(selectNotNullElement);
            }
            sql.addElement(selectTrimElement);
            parentElement.addElement(sql);
            
            // 公用select
            sb.setLength(0);
            sb.append("select ");
            sb.append("t.* ");
            sb.append("from ");
            sb.append(introspectedTable.getFullyQualifiedTableNameAtRuntime());
            sb.append(" t");
            TextElement selectText = new TextElement(sb.toString());
            
            // 公用include
            XmlElement include = new XmlElement("include");
            include.addAttribute(new Attribute("refid", "base_query"));
            
            // 增加find
            XmlElement find = new XmlElement("select");
            find.addAttribute(new Attribute("id", "find"));
            find.addAttribute(new Attribute("resultMap", "BaseResultMap"));
            find.addAttribute(new Attribute("parameterType", introspectedTable.getBaseRecordType()));
            find.addElement(selectText);
            find.addElement(include);
            parentElement.addElement(find);
            
            // 增加list
            XmlElement list = new XmlElement("select");
            list.addAttribute(new Attribute("id", "list"));
            list.addAttribute(new Attribute("resultMap", "BaseResultMap"));
            list.addAttribute(new Attribute("parameterType", introspectedTable.getBaseRecordType()));
            list.addElement(selectText);
            list.addElement(include);
            parentElement.addElement(list);
            
            // 增加pageList
            XmlElement pageList = new XmlElement("select");
            pageList.addAttribute(new Attribute("id", "pageList"));
            pageList.addAttribute(new Attribute("resultMap", "BaseResultMap"));
            pageList.addAttribute(new Attribute("parameterType", introspectedTable.getBaseRecordType()));
            pageList.addElement(selectText);
            pageList.addElement(include);
            parentElement.addElement(pageList);
        }
    
    }

    CustomJavaMapperMethodGenerator 代码

    public class CustomJavaMapperMethodGenerator extends AbstractJavaMapperMethodGenerator {
    
        @Override
        public void addInterfaceElements(Interface interfaze) {
            
            addInterfaceFind(interfaze);
            addInterfaceList(interfaze);
            addInterfacePageList(interfaze);
        }
        
        private void addInterfaceFind(Interface interfaze) {
            // 先创建import对象
            Set<FullyQualifiedJavaType> importedTypes = new TreeSet<FullyQualifiedJavaType>();
            // 添加Lsit的包
            importedTypes.add(FullyQualifiedJavaType.getNewListInstance());
            // 创建方法对象
            Method method = new Method();
            // 设置该方法为public
            method.setVisibility(JavaVisibility.PUBLIC);
            // 设置返回类型是List
            FullyQualifiedJavaType returnType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            // 方法对象设置返回类型对象
            method.setReturnType(returnType);
            // 设置方法名称为我们在IntrospectedTable类中初始化的 “selectByObject”
            method.setName("find");
    
            // 设置参数类型是对象
            FullyQualifiedJavaType parameterType;
            parameterType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            // import参数类型对象
            importedTypes.add(parameterType);
            // 为方法添加参数,变量名称record
            method.addParameter(new Parameter(parameterType, "record")); //$NON-NLS-1$
            //
            addMapperAnnotations(interfaze, method);
            context.getCommentGenerator().addGeneralMethodComment(method, introspectedTable);
            if (context.getPlugins().clientSelectByPrimaryKeyMethodGenerated(method, interfaze, introspectedTable)) {
                interfaze.addImportedTypes(importedTypes);
                interfaze.addMethod(method);
            }
        }
        
        private void addInterfaceList(Interface interfaze) {
            // 先创建import对象
            Set<FullyQualifiedJavaType> importedTypes = new TreeSet<FullyQualifiedJavaType>();
            // 添加Lsit的包
            importedTypes.add(FullyQualifiedJavaType.getNewListInstance());
            // 创建方法对象
            Method method = new Method();
            // 设置该方法为public
            method.setVisibility(JavaVisibility.PUBLIC);
            // 设置返回类型是List
            FullyQualifiedJavaType returnType = FullyQualifiedJavaType.getNewListInstance();
            FullyQualifiedJavaType listType;
            // 设置List的类型是实体类的对象
            listType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            importedTypes.add(listType);
            // 返回类型对象设置为List
            returnType.addTypeArgument(listType);
            // 方法对象设置返回类型对象
            method.setReturnType(returnType);
            // 设置方法名称为我们在IntrospectedTable类中初始化的 “selectByObject”
            method.setName("list");
    
            // 设置参数类型是对象
            FullyQualifiedJavaType parameterType;
            parameterType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            // import参数类型对象
            importedTypes.add(parameterType);
            // 为方法添加参数,变量名称record
            method.addParameter(new Parameter(parameterType, "record")); //$NON-NLS-1$
            //
            addMapperAnnotations(interfaze, method);
            context.getCommentGenerator().addGeneralMethodComment(method, introspectedTable);
            if (context.getPlugins().clientSelectByPrimaryKeyMethodGenerated(method, interfaze, introspectedTable)) {
                interfaze.addImportedTypes(importedTypes);
                interfaze.addMethod(method);
            }
        }
        
        private void addInterfacePageList(Interface interfaze) {
            // 先创建import对象
            Set<FullyQualifiedJavaType> importedTypes = new TreeSet<FullyQualifiedJavaType>();
            // 添加Lsit的包
            importedTypes.add(FullyQualifiedJavaType.getNewListInstance());
            // 创建方法对象
            Method method = new Method();
            // 设置该方法为public
            method.setVisibility(JavaVisibility.PUBLIC);
            // 设置返回类型是List
            FullyQualifiedJavaType returnType = FullyQualifiedJavaType.getNewListInstance();
            FullyQualifiedJavaType listType;
            // 设置List的类型是实体类的对象
            listType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            importedTypes.add(listType);
            // 返回类型对象设置为List
            returnType.addTypeArgument(listType);
            // 方法对象设置返回类型对象
            method.setReturnType(returnType);
            // 设置方法名称为我们在IntrospectedTable类中初始化的 “selectByObject”
            method.setName("pageList");
    
            // 设置参数类型是对象
            FullyQualifiedJavaType parameterType;
            parameterType = new FullyQualifiedJavaType(introspectedTable.getBaseRecordType());
            // import参数类型对象
            importedTypes.add(parameterType);
            // 为方法添加参数,变量名称record
            method.addParameter(new Parameter(parameterType, "record")); //$NON-NLS-1$
            //
            addMapperAnnotations(interfaze, method);
            context.getCommentGenerator().addGeneralMethodComment(method, introspectedTable);
            if (context.getPlugins().clientSelectByPrimaryKeyMethodGenerated(method, interfaze, introspectedTable)) {
                interfaze.addImportedTypes(importedTypes);
                interfaze.addMethod(method);
            }
        }
    
        public void addMapperAnnotations(Interface interfaze, Method method) {
        }
    }

     执行代码

    public class TestGenerator {
    
        private static File configFile;
        static {
            String path = System.getProperty("user.dir").concat("\\src\\resource\\generatorConfiguration.xml");
            System.out.println(path);
            configFile = new File(path);
        }
        
        public static void main(String[] args)
                throws IOException,
                        XMLParserException,
                        InvalidConfigurationException,
                        SQLException,
                        InterruptedException {
            
            if(!configFile.exists()) {
                System.out.println("配置文件不存在");
                return;
            }
            
            List<String> warnings = new ArrayList<String>();
            boolean overwrite = true;
            ConfigurationParser cp = new ConfigurationParser(warnings);
            Configuration config = cp.parseConfiguration(configFile);
            DefaultShellCallback callback = new DefaultShellCallback(overwrite);
            MyBatisGenerator myBatisGenerator = new MyBatisGenerator(config, callback, warnings);
            myBatisGenerator.generate(null);
        }
    }

    自此,扩展结束。
